Abia North: Kalu goes to tribunal

FORMER governor of Abia State and senatorial candidate of the Progressive Peoples Al­liance (PPA) in the March 5, 2016, Abia North rerun elec­tion, Dr. Orji Kalu, has gone to the just-empanelled tribunal in Umuahia to protest massive electoral irregularities that robbed him of victory in the poll.
Mr. K. C. Nwufor (SAN) leads Dr. Kalu’s four-man legal team of Senior Advocates of Nigeria (SAN).
The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) had earlier on Sunday morn­ing, March 6, 2016, declared the rerun election inconclusive, only to return in the afternoon to make a volte-face by an­nouncing the Peoples Demo­cratic Party (PDP) candidate, Mr. Mao Ohuabunwa, winner of the rerun poll in very con­troversial circumstances to the chagrin of observers and other parties that participated in the election.
Recall that the same forces behind the current electoral fraud were the same people that rigged Dr. Kalu out of the 2011, 2015 and 2016 senatorial polls.
This time, Dr. Kalu has vowed not to allow this swindle to become a permanent feature in Abia State by approaching the tribunal to rectify the latest anomaly by calling the perpe­trators to order and enthroning political accountability.
